Output e6827c3a7f30b9ab76694e7d4faaec9ffb692a90ad56fc7a1dfdd3050e742454: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a5ad9af0adbc609a979a1bf5fc927d4f09589c OP_EQUAL
address
34rDNauMNKBWjC4c8SgpDqgbgJ1jZzaxRq
transaction
e6827c3a7f30b9ab76694e7d4faaec9ffb692a90ad56fc7a1dfdd3050e742454
confirmations
131208
spent
true